    Interface says no player

    I've been running LMS for years without any problems. Today, after updating Windows, the interface says No Player and I can't find any way to get to select one. I can play radio from the Internet so the networking is okay.

    I'm totally lost as to what is causing this. The Squeezebox Touch is plugged into the same switch as the PC with the library on. LMS is running without errors.

    I can't find any firewall issues.

    Anyone got any idea what is causing this?

        probably what happend is your player was connected to mysqueezebox.com. By selecting my music, you are requesting the player connect to LMS (which is the only place you can access your local music files).

        Why did it happen? Probably LMS was not running after your windows update. It has happened to me before (seemingly) no reason. At some point you tried to use the player when LMS was not available/running, so the player possible said (something like) "could not connect, switch to mysb.com?" then it did.

        If you are not familiar, mysb.com is basically a cloud server (before we called then cloud servers), where you use the players with installing LMS on say, a pc/mac/other. It is the "out of the box/get it working/stream internet/pandora/etc" solution. You installed LMS to get alot more function including local music.

        If you want to replicate what probably happened, on the touch go to settings->advanced->networking->switch to mysb.com. Then log into mysb.com on your pc browser. Go to players. You should see your touch connected, and the LMS control UI should have the touch "missing". Then as Michael says, choose my music, the browser mysb.com will still have the player listed, but not connected, and the player should be in the LMS UI

              #7
              Touch doesn't resolve those addresses - it is LMS that does it for it.
              So check the LMS logs to see if there are some clues there.

                A guess - since your windows update (or related) seemed to affect LMS (player could not find, switch to mysb.com) - maybe something to do with the lms connection to mysb.com also got affected.

                I am not sure what you mean by "I used to be able to connect to mysb.com without issues but now I can't"? Have you tried to log into mysb.com on your pc using your credentials with a browser? If that works, in LMS go to settings->mysb.com and reenter your credentials, hit apply.

                As Paul mentions, check the logs. LMS->settings->information->Logitech Media Server Log File

                I also hope that you rebooted everything - modem, router, PC, touch...in that order.

                If all else fails you can reinstall LMS (which I have had to do). There are some things you can do to save/restore favorites and plugins. Check back before you reinstall.
